Thanks both.

 

The effect was done by a sponge(the stuff that comes in the blister packs). Was applied by "dry brush/sponge" , rather than wet paint. First coat was white to a decent level then a tiny amount of blue, same technique.

Thanks both,

 

@Marshal Pentacost, its the two outer parts on the IG valk converted together. As the two outer bits are way fatter than the tail of the ST I had to cut and file very carefully so it matched up with the tail bit on the ST and to gradually get it thinner to the tip.
